Understanding Hydroclimatic Changes in Central Asia
Recent studies conducted by scientists have shed light on the hydroclimatic changes that have occurred in Central Asia over the past 7,800 years. These findings provide valuable insights into the region’s climate history and how it has evolved over multiple timescales.
Key Findings
The research indicates that Central Asia has experienced significant fluctuations in hydroclimatic conditions, including periods of increased aridity and wetness. These changes have had a profound impact on the region’s ecosystems and water resources.
Implications
By understanding the past hydroclimatic changes in Central Asia, scientists can better predict future climate trends and develop strategies to mitigate potential risks. This knowledge is crucial for sustainable water management and environmental conservation efforts in the region.
